vim Makefile 1 myfile myfile.c 2 gcc -o myfile myfile.c 3 4 .PHONY: clean 5 clean: 6 rm -f myfile 如何改
时间: 2023-06-06 20:07:31 浏览: 108
进入 Vim 编辑器后,可以按下 i 键进入插入模式,然后在第一行输入以下内容:
```Makefile
CC=gcc
CFLAGS=-Wall -Wextra -std=c99
.PHONY: all clean
all: myfile
myfile: myfile.c
$(CC) $(CFLAGS) -o $@ $<
clean:
rm -f myfile
```
这个 Makefile 中,我们定义了 CC 和 CFLAGS 变量,用来指定编译器和编译选项。在 all 规则中,我们指定了 myfile 作为目标文件,依赖于 myfile.c 源文件,然后使用编译器将它们编译链接成可执行文件。在 clean 规则中,我们删除生成的可执行文件。
阅读全文